    Canon IR 400 b/b paper jamming

    this ir400 print - 1 side ok
    2 sided prints - paper jams after passing thru drum on back side print.
    checked transfer & replaced but the same problem
    any help please

    One sided ok, this mean m/c is ok. The cause for the jam is the curl of the paper after it passes thru the heater, then coming back for the double side. It is advisable that you change another brand of paper or heavier paper ( 80g ). If the jam still occur then you ask your client to use A4R paper, but first the auto orientation must be on.

        Whenever a printer keeps jamming in the same way, even with ttwo completely different stacks of paper, from two completely different reams of paper, in the feed tray...
        ...it's nearly also a DIRTY paper path and DIRTY rubber rollers.
        It could also be a piece of paper from a previous jam lodged into the paper path somewhere... probably from someone just yanking it out, and then leaving behind a small piece.
